Yes, but that would require switching speaker cables.

I did some more looking at the link I posted earlier, and I believe
this is what you can do:

The RCA and Balanced output the same thing, but you'll need a way to
set the levels properly as one is 6dB louder. 

Since the Moscode will be sitting there anyway, you may as well use it
for the mains while using surround sound as well:

Transporter balanced out->Pre/Pro Balanced Analog Input...

AVM50 Balanced output to Rear L/R and Center Balanced Input on
MCA50>3.1 speakers.
AVM50 Unbalanced output to Moscode amp>Front L/R speakers.

You should then be able to set the balanced analog input to direct
bypass, and the HDMI input to 5.1, while using the same front speakers.


The RCA analog output from the Transporter could also be ran directly
to the input of the moscode, if you felt like switching the RCA's
occasionally for critical listening. You can use the analog attenuation
built into the Transporter to match levels there. And then there's the
digital output of the Transporter you could send to the AVM50 to
compare the sound...
